The Taming of the Teen
WOMEN!

Shea Delaney just couldn't understand the female of the species. He had gotten along great with his daughter when she was a tomboy--but now she wanted to become a lady. He certainly didn't know what to tell her! In desperation, the widowed father turned to child psychologist Dottie McClellan--and got much more than he had bargained for.

The vibrant and irrepressible Dottie knew it would be no trouble to teach Shea's teenage daughter sophisticated manners and womanly ways. Her real challenge--one she found impossible to resist--would be to show the reluctant but gorgeous Shea Delaney that it was time for him to make some changes, too. How could she convince this love-shy man to see her as a lady. . .his lady?
